State Board Licensing Reform
November 8, 2019 11:40 AM to All House Members
Circulated By
Photo of Representative Representative Greg Rothman
Representative Greg Rothman
R House District 87
Along With
Photo of Representative Rep. Kyle Mullins
Rep. Kyle Mullins
D House District 112
Memo
We will be introducing legislation that will provide additional recourse to victims of cases that are heard before any of our state’s licensing boards. 
 
Specifically, the legislation requires a defendant/respondent to appear in person for any scheduled hearing that is being held before a licensing board, commission or hearing examiner.  In addition, the victim or anyone directly affected by the defendant/respondent’s actions or wrongdoing, would have the opportunity to provide a victim’s statement to the board.
 
Our proposed legislation would close a gap that currently exists in law, as it relates to consumer protection.
